Thorp is a city located in Clark County, Wisconsin. Thorp has a 2025 population of 1,764 . Thorp is currently declining at a rate of -0.28% annually and its population has decreased by -1.4%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 1,789 in 2020.
The average household income in Thorp is $70,780 with a poverty rate of 8.55%. The median age in Thorp is 41.9 years: 44.8 years for males, and 40.5 years for females. For every 100 females there are 95.2 males.

Thorp's average per capita income is $46,350. Household income levels show a median of $56,800. The poverty rate stands at 8.55%.
Name | Median | Mean |
|---|---|---|
| Married Families | $75,667 | - |
| Families | $70,938 | $81,683 |
| Households | $56,800 | $70,780 |
| Non Families | $39,083 | $43,856 |
